Product: CNG - The Fuel of the Future
CNG has been widely used in vehicles since the 1930s, in countries that include Argentina, Russia and Italy. It is gaining increasing acceptance, particularly for city transport vehicles such as taxis, buses and delivery trucks due to its relative superiority over other conventional fuels.
WHAT IS CNG?
CNG is compressed natural gas. It mainly consists of methane (91.9%), with other constituents like ethane, propane and butane. It is an intrinsically pure fuel that emits negligible quantities of pollutants when burnt. Natural gas is compressed to a pressure of 200-250 kg/cm (to be stored in a cylinder) and hence the name Compressed Natural Gas. It is colorless, odourless, non-toxic, non-carcinogenic and lighter than air. CNG is not the same as LPG (Liquefied Petroleum Gas) or LNG (Liquefied Natural Gas). Compressed Natural Gas is a low smoke, low pollution, safe and cheaper (than petrol) fuel. It has been successfully and widely utilized by the transportation sector in developed countries worldwide.
